> Willem may have already fixed this.
> 
> Consider this (which wouldn't be a bad example for the doc): It adds a
> log, a webapp, and some static content to the server. All is well,
> except that the process seems never to exit. Is this just 'fixed in
> 2.0.3'?
> 
> <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
> 
> <beans xmlns="http://www.springframework.org/schema/beans";
> x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ance";
>  xmlns:sec="http://cxf.apache.org/configuration/security";
>  xmlns:http="http://cxf.apache.org/transports/http/configuration";
>
xmlns:httpj="http://cxf.apache.org/transports/http-jetty/configuration";
> xmlns:jaxws="http://java.sun.com/xml/ns/jaxws";
>  xsi:schemaLocation="http://cxf.apache.org/configuration/security
>           http://cxf.apache.org/schemas/configuration/security.xsd
>             http://cxf.apache.org/transports/http/configuration
>             http://cxf.apache.org/schemas/configuration/http-conf.xsd
>             http://cxf.apache.org/transports/http-jetty/configuration
>             http://cxf.apache.org/schemas/configuration/http-jetty.xsd
>             http://www.springframework.org/schema/beans
> 
> http://www.springframework.org/schema/beans/spring-beans-2.0.xsd";>
> 
>  <httpj:engine-factory bus="cxf">
>   <httpj:engine port="8808">
>    <httpj:handlers>
>     <bean class="org.mortbay.jetty.handler.RequestLogHandler">
>       <property name="requestLog">
>         <bean class="org.mortbay.jetty.NCSARequestLog">
>          <property name="filename" value="jetty.log"/>
>         </bean>
>       </property>
>     </bean>
>     <bean class="org.mortbay.jetty.webapp.WebAppContext">
>       <constructor-arg value="${jsunitPathname}"/>
>       <constructor-arg value="/jsunit"/>
>     </bean>
>     <bean class="org.mortbay.jetty.handler.ContextHandler">
>      <property name="contextPath" value="/${staticResourceBase}" />
>      <property name="handler">
>       <bean class="org.mortbay.jetty.handler.ResourceHandler">
>        <property name="baseResource">
>         <bean class="org.mortbay.resource.FileResource">
>          <constructor-arg value="${staticResourceURL}" />
>         </bean>
>         </property>
>       </bean>
>      </property>
>     </bean>
>    </httpj:handlers>
>   </httpj:engine>
>  </httpj:engine-factory>
> </beans>
